NDIS_WMI_ENUM_ADAPTER Struktur (ntddndis.h)
Die NDIS_WMI_ENUM_ADAPTER Struktur wird zurückgegeben, wenn NDIS auf die GUID_NDIS_ENUMERATE_ADAPTERS_EX GUID.
Syntax
typedef struct _NDIS_WMI_ENUM_ADAPTER {
NDIS_OBJECT_HEADER Header;
NET_IFINDEX IfIndex;
NET_LUID NetLuid;
USHORT DeviceNameLength;
CHAR DeviceName[1];
} NDIS_WMI_ENUM_ADAPTER, *PNDIS_WMI_ENUM_ADAPTER;
Angehörige
Header
Die NDIS_OBJECT_HEADER Struktur für diese NDIS_WMI_ENUM_ADAPTER Struktur. Legen Sie das element Type von NDIS_OBJECT_HEADER auf NDIS_WMI_OBJECT_TYPE_ENUM_ADAPTER fest, das Revision Member auf NDIS_WMI_ENUM_ADAPTER_REVISION_1 und das Size member to sizeof(NDIS_WMI_ENUM_ADAPTER).
IfIndex
Der NDIS-Schnittstellenindex der NDIS-Miniportadapterschnittstelle, die der GUID zugeordnet ist.
NetLuid
Der NDIS-Netzwerkschnittstellenname des Miniportadapters.
DeviceNameLength
Die Länge des Gerätenamens der NDIS-Miniportadapterschnittstelle, die der GUID zugeordnet ist.
DeviceName[1]
Der Gerätename der NDIS-Miniportadapterschnittstelle, die der GUID zugeordnet ist. Der Gerätename ist eine mit Null beendete breite Zeichenfolge.
Bemerkungen
NDIS gibt die NDIS_WMI_ENUM_ADAPTER Struktur zurück, wenn sie Miniportadapter für WMI-Clients aufzählt. Weitere Informationen zum Aufzählen von Miniportadaptern für WMI-Clients finden Sie unter GUID_NDIS_ENUMERATE_ADAPTERS_EX.
Anforderungen
Anforderung | Wert |
---|---|
mindestens unterstützte Client- | Unterstützt in NDIS 6.0 und höher. |
Header- | ntddndis.h (include Ndis.h) |